At DBA Tower, we recently faced a challenging issue with one of our retail e-commerce clients. The client was experiencing significant performance bottlenecks in their SQL Server database, which was impacting their overall platform performance and user experience. This blog post outlines the problem statement, the actions we took to resolve the issue, and the results we achieved.
Problem Statement
The client’s e-commerce platform was suffering from slow query performance, frequent timeouts, and high CPU usage. These issues were causing delays in order processing, inventory updates, and customer interactions. The root cause was identified as inefficient SQL queries and suboptimal database configuration.
Our Action for Solution
Our team at DBA Tower conducted a comprehensive SQL health check to identify the problematic areas. We started by analyzing the slow-running queries and optimizing them for better performance. This involved rewriting complex queries, adding appropriate indexes, and removing redundant data. We also reviewed the database configuration settings and made necessary adjustments to improve resource allocation and utilization.
In addition to query optimization, we implemented a robust monitoring system to continuously track the database performance. This allowed us to proactively address any emerging issues and ensure the database was running smoothly. We also provided the client with best practices for maintaining their SQL Server database to prevent future performance problems.
Results
The results of our efforts were remarkable. The client’s e-commerce platform experienced a significant improvement in performance. Query execution times were reduced by up to 70%, and CPU usage dropped by 50%. The platform’s overall responsiveness improved, leading to faster order processing and a better user experience. The client was extremely satisfied with the outcome and appreciated our expertise in SQL Server performance tuning.
At DBA Tower, we pride ourselves on our ability to solve complex SQL Server issues and enhance database performance. If you’re facing similar challenges, our team of experts is here to help. Contact us today to learn more about our SQL Server consultation services.